Yes, there's lots of mullets in that area and the place is a swamp-like habitat. But like any other reservoirs, they will open the floodgate whenever there's heavy rain, muddy water will be gushing down the river. The area is pretty big, it's also where the old RSYC used to be. There's a few sunken boats there but probably broken down to bits and pieces by now, used to be a great spot for snappers and groupers. I reckon the place is still good to try out for kbls and cudas.

Bread should be the preferred bait for mullets, but be sure to berly the bread till they get into the mood of feeding. I got a clip I took several years ago just outside Pandan Floodgate, not sure how the place has become now. I know there used to be schools of mullets there. ;)
